Danville, CA (Sept. 9, 2026) – San Ramon Valley Unified School District (SRVUSD) is proud to announce that 68 of its high school seniors have been named Semifinalists in the 2027 National Merit Scholarship Program. These outstanding students represent the academic excellence and dedication of SRVUSD students and school communities. Semifinalists now have the opportunity to advance to Finalist standing and compete for National Merit Scholarships to be awarded in spring 2027.
On September 9, 2026, officials of the National Merit Scholarship Corporation (NMSC®) announced the names of more than 16,000 Semifinalists in the 72nd annual National Merit Scholarship Program. SRVUSD’s 68 Semifinalists are among the highest-scoring students in California, representing the top 1% of the state’s senior students.
Students qualified for the 2027 National Merit Scholarship Program through the Preliminary SAT/National Merit Scholarship Qualifying Test (PSAT/NMSQT®), which SRVUSD offers to all juniors, in fall 2025. To advance to Finalist standing, Semifinalists must fulfill several additional requirements. National Merit Scholarship winners will be selected from the Finalist group in spring 2027.

The program is conducted by the National Merit Scholarship Corporation (NMSC) whose mission is to recognize and honor the academically talented students of the United States. NMSC accomplishes its mission by conducting nationwide academic scholarship programs. The enduring goals of NMSC’s scholarship programs are:
- To promote a wider and deeper respect for learning in general and for exceptionally talented individuals in particular
- To shine a spotlight on brilliant students and encourage the pursuit of academic excellence at all levels of education
- To stimulate increased support from individuals and organizations that wish to sponsor scholarships for outstanding scholastic talent

About San Ramon Valley Unified School District: Located in the San Francisco Bay Area, San Ramon Valley Unified School District (SRVUSD) is one of the highest-achieving school districts in California. With approximately 28,500 students, the district encompasses the communities of Alamo, Danville, San Ramon, and a small portion of Walnut Creek and Pleasanton.
SRVUSD has been recognized at state and national levels with many awards and achievements and is designated as a Learning 2025 Lighthouse District by AASA, the School Superintendents Association.
